Model Engine Fuel Economy (City/Highway) Approx. Price (CAD)
Mazda3 2.0L 4-cylinder, 155 horsepower 8.5 L/100 km / 6.2 L/100 km $17,000 - $20,000
Nissan Versa 1.6L 4-cylinder, 122 horsepower 7.4 L/100 km / 5.9 L/100 km $18,000 - $21,000
Mazda MX-5 Miata 2.0L 4-cylinder, 155 horsepower 9.0 L/100 km / 6.6 L/100 km $19,000 - $24,000
Kia Forte 2.0L 4-cylinder, 147 horsepower 7.9 L/100 km / 5.9 L/100 km $18,000 - $21,000
Hyundai Elantra 2.0L 4-cylinder, 147 horsepower 8.3 L/100 km / 6.4 L/100 km $16,000 - $19,000
Subaru Impreza 2.0L 4-cylinder, 152 horsepower 8.3 L/100 km / 6.4 L/100 km $18,000 - $22,000
Ford Escape XLT V6 4WD 3.0L V6, 240 horsepower 12.0 L/100 km / 8.6 L/100 km $15,000 - $19,000
Hyundai Veloster 2.0L 4-cylinder, 147 horsepower 8.5 L/100 km / 6.4 L/100 km $17,000 - $20,000
Honda Civic 2.0L 4-cylinder, 158 horsepower 8.0 L/100 km / 6.0 L/100 km $18,000 - $22,000
Toyota Camry 2.5L 4-cylinder, 203 horsepower 8.5 L/100 km / 6.1 L/100 km $19,000 - $23,000
Chevrolet Spark 1.4L 4-cylinder, 98 horsepower 7.9 L/100 km / 6.2 L/100 km $14,000 - $17,000

1. 2021 Mazda3

 

2021 Mazda3

 

The Mazda3 has been a popular choice among Canadian drivers for its combination of stylish design, engaging driving dynamics, and premium interior. The 2021 model continues this tradition with a refined driving experience that rivals more expensive vehicles in its class.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: Pow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ine, the Mazda3 delivers 155 horsepower, providing a good balance between performance and fuel efficiency.
  • Fuel Economy: With an impressive 8.5 L/100 km in the city and 6.2 L/100 km on the highway, the Mazda3 is economical to run.
  • Interior: The interior features high-quality materials, including soft-touch surfaces and an ergonomic design. The infotainment system is user-friendly, with an 8.8-inch display that supports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.
  • Safety: The Mazda3 is equipped with advanced safety features such as lane-keep assist, adaptive cruise control, and automatic emergency braking. The vehicle's overall build quality and safety technology make it a strong contender for anyone looking for a reliable and safe car.

 

The 2021 Mazda3 stands out for its upscale feel, making it an excellent choice for those who want a premium driving experience without breaking the bank.

 

2. 2024 Nissan Versa

 

2024 Nissan Versa

 

The Nissan Versa is known for being one of the most affordable cars in its segment, and the 2024 model continues to deliver excellent value with its combination of modern features and practicality. Despite its low price, the Versa doesn’t skimp on comfort or technology.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Versa is powered by a 1.6L 4-cylinder engine producing 122 horsepower. While not the most powerful, it’s sufficient for city driving and highway cruising.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ers excellent fuel efficiency, with ratings of 7.4 L/100 km in the city and 5.9 L/100 km on the highway, making it a cost-effective option for daily commuters.
  • Interior: The cabin is surprisingly spacious for a subcompact car, offering comfortable seating for five. It includes a 7-inch touchscreen, Bluetooth connectivity, and the added convenience of remote keyless entry.
  • Safety: Nissan's Safety Shield 360 comes standard, including features like automatic emergency braking, rear cross-traffic alert, and blind-spot monitoring.

 

The 2024 Nissan Versa is perfect for budget-conscious buyers who don’t want to compromise on essential features and safety.

 

3. 2018 Mazda MX-5 Miata

 

 

2018 Mazda MX-5 Miata

 

The Mazda MX-5 Miata has long been the go-to roadster for driving enthusiasts. The 2018 model continues to impress with its lightweight design, nimble handling, and a truly engaging driving experience that few cars in this price range can match.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Miata is pow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ine producing 155 horsepower, which might seem modest but is more than enough given the car’s lightweight.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ers respectable fuel efficiency at 9.0 L/100 km in the city and 6.6 L/100 km on the highway, which is great for a sports car.
  • Interior: The Miata's interior is minimalist yet functional, with comfortable sports seats and straightforward controls. The infotainment system is easy to use, though it's basic compared to more modern systems.
  • Safety: Standard safety features include stability control, traction control, and side airbags, which help provide peace of mind despite the car's small size.

 

The 2018 Mazda MX-5 Miata is ideal for those who prioritize driving pleasure and don’t mind sacrificing a bit of practicality for the sake of fun.

4. 2022 Kia Forte

 

2022 Kia Forte

 

The 2022 Kia Forte offers a well-rounded package that includes a comfortable ride, modern technology, and solid build quality. It’s a great choice for anyone looking for a compact sedan that delivers more than its price tag suggests.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Forte is pow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ine with 147 horsepower, offering a smooth and efficient driving experience.
  • Fuel Economy: It boasts a fuel efficiency of 7.9 L/100 km in the city and 5.9 L/100 km on the highway, making it an economical choice for both city and highway driving.
  • Interior: The interior is spacious and well-appointed, featuring an 8-inch touchscreen,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, and a comfortable seating arrangement.
  • Safety: Safety is a strong point for the Forte, with features like forward collision warning, lane departure warning, and driver attention monitoring coming standard.

 

The 2022 Kia Forte is a practical and stylish choice for drivers who want a reliable vehicle with modern amenities.

 

5. 2020 Hyundai Elantra

 

2020 Hyundai Elantra

 

The Hyundai Elantra has been a staple in the compact sedan market for years, known for its reliability, fuel efficiency, and value. The 2020 model builds on this reputation with a modern design and a well-equipped interior.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Elantra comes with a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ine that produces 147 horsepower, providing a good balance of power and efficiency.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ers a fuel economy of 8.3 L/100 km in the city and 6.4 L/100 km on the highway, making it a cost-effective vehicle for daily use.
  • Interior: The cabin is well-designed, with a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system that includes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. The seating is comfortable, and the overall construction is sturdy.
  • Safety: The Elantra is equipped with several advanced safety features, including bl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and lane-keeping assist, enhancing driver confidence.

 

The 2020 Hyundai Elantra is a strong contender for anyone looking for a reliable and economical sedan with modern features.

 

6. Subaru Impreza

 

Subaru Impreza

 

The Subaru Impreza is unique in the compact car segment for offering standard all-wheel drive, making it an excellent choice for Canadian drivers who face harsh winter conditions. It’s also known for its safety and practicality.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Impreza is pow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ine that produces 152 horsepower. While not the most powerful, it’s adequate for everyday driving and performs well in all weather conditions.
  • Fuel Economy: The Impreza achieves 8.3 L/100 km in city driving and 6.4 L/100 km on the highway, a strong performance for an all-wheel-drive model.
  • Interior: The interior is durable and comfortable, with a Starlink infotainment system that includes a touchscreen, smartphone integration, and a straightforward layout.
  • Safety: Subaru’s EyeSight driver assist technology includes adaptive cruise control, pre-collision braking, and lane departure warning, making it one of the safest vehicles in its class.

 

The Subaru Impreza is perfect for drivers who need a reliable and capable vehicle that can handle Canada’s diverse climate.

 

7. Ford Escape XLT V6 4WD

 

Ford Escape XLT V6 4WD

 

The Ford Escape XLT V6 4WD is an excellent option for those who need a versatile SUV with strong performance and off-road capability. It’s particularly well-suited for families and individuals who enjoy outdoor activities.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: This model is powered by a robust 3.0L V6 engine that produces 240 horsepower, offering plenty of power for highway driving and off-road adventures.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ers a fuel economy of 12.0 L/100 km in the city and 8.6 L/100 km on the highway, which is typical for a V6-powered SUV.
  • Interior: The interior boasts spaciousness, leather seating, an easy-to-use infotainment system, and plenty of cargo room. Folding down the rear seats provides extra space for bigger loads.
  • Safety: The Escape comes with four-wheel drive, stability control, and multiple airbags, providing confidence in a variety of driving conditions.

 

The Ford Escape XLT V6 4WD is ideal for those who need an SUV that can handle a wide range of tasks, from daily commuting to weekend getaways in the great outdoors.

 

8. 2020 Hyundai Veloster

 

2020 Hyundai Veloster

 

The Hyundai Veloster is a unique offering in the compact car segment, with its distinctive three-door design and sporty handling. The 2020 model is fun to drive and offers a good mix of performance and practicality.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Veloster is pow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ine that produces 147 horsepower, providing a lively driving experience.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ers a fuel economy of 8.5 L/100 km in the city and 6.4 L/100 km on the highway, making it both fun and economical to drive.
  • Interior: The interior features a 7-inch touchscreen with Bluetooth connectivity, comfortable seats, and a stylish design that sets it apart from more conventional compact cars.
  • Safety: The Veloster includes safety features such as forward collision warning, lane-keeping assist, and driver attention alert, ensuring a secure driving experience.

 

The 2020 Hyundai Veloster is perfect for those who want a car that’s a little different and offers a sporty driving experience without sacrificing practicality.

9. Honda Civic

 

Honda Civic

 

The Honda Civic has been one of Canada’s best-selling cars for decades, and for good reason. It’s reliable, fuel-efficient, and holds its value well, making it an excellent choice for a used car under $20,000.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Civic is powered by a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ine that delivers 158 horsepower, providing a balanced mix of performance and efficiency.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ers a fuel economy of 8.0 L/100 km in the city and 6.0 L/100 km on the highway, making it one of the most economical options in its class.
  • Interior: The Civic’s interior is spacious and well-designed, featuring a 7-inch touchscreen with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. The seats provide comfort, and the interior is spacious enough for passengers and cargo alike.
  • Safety: Honda’s Sensing safety suite includes features like ad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and collision mitigation braking, making the Civic one of the safest choices in the compact sedan segment.

 

The Honda Civic is a no-brainer for anyone looking for a reliable, fuel-efficient, and well-equipped compact car.

 

10. Toyota Camry

 

Toyota Camry

 

The Toyota Camry is a trusted sedan that delivers a smooth driving experience, ample interior space, and impressive long-term dependability. It’s a great option for those who want a mid-sized sedan with low maintenance costs.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Camry is powered by a 2.5L 4-cylinder engine that produces 203 horsepower, providing ample power for most driving situations.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ers a fuel economy of 8.5 L/100 km in the city and 6.1 L/100 km on the highway, making it an economical choice for a mid-sized sedan.
  • Interior: The interior is upscale, with high-quality materials, a 7-inch infotainment screen, and dual-zone climate control. The seats are comfortable and supportive, with generous legroom for passengers in both the front and back.
  • Safety: Toyota Safety Sense is standard, including a pre-collision system, lane departure alert, and adaptive cruise control, making the Camry one of the safest cars in its class.

 

The Toyota Camry is perfect for those who want a reliable, comfortable, and safe sedan that’s built to last.

 

11. Chevrolet Spark

 

Chevrolet Spark

 

The Chevrolet Spark is a compact car that’s perfect for city driving, offering excellent maneuverability, fuel efficiency, and an affordable price tag. It’s a reliable and cost-effective choice for buyers in search of a practical used vehicle.

 

Key Features:

  • Engine: The Spark is powered by a 1.4L 4-cylinder engine that produces 98 horsepower. While it’s not the most powerful, it’s more than adequate for city driving.
  • Fuel Economy: It offers an impressive fuel economy of 7.9 L/100 km in the city and 6.2 L/100 km on the highway, making it one of the most economical cars on the market.
  • Interior: Despite its small size, the Spark’s interior is surprisingly spacious, with a 7-inch touchscreen that includes smartphone integration and a rearview camera. The seats are comfortable, and there’s a surprising amount of cargo space with the rear seats folded down.
  • Safety: The Spark includes 10 airbags, rear park assist, and stability control, making it a safe choice for urban driving.

 

The Chevrolet Spark is an excellent choice for those who need an affordable and fuel-efficient car for navigating city streets.

Frequently Asked Questions

 

1. What's the best car to buy for under 20k?

It depends on your needs. For sportiness, choose the Mazda MX-5 Miata. For reliability, go with the Honda Civic or Toyota Camry. For a unique design, the Hyundai Veloster is great.

 

2. What used car has the least problems?

The Toyota Camry and Honda Civic are known for exceptional reliability and low maintenance issues.

 

3. What is the best mileage for a second-hand car?

Ideally, look for a car with under 100,000 kilometers, but well-maintained higher-mileage cars can also be good options.

 

4. What is the best used Honda CR-V to buy?

The 2016-2018 Honda CR-V models offer a great balance of reliability, safety, and modern features.
